4th Cut.In Results

Jurry Members

K.P Jayasankar, Anjali Panjabi, Jagannathan Krishnan

Jury Citation

The Jury was impressed by the diversity of the films. While the quality in the fiction category was note-worthy, the PSA and the documentary section did not reflect the large body of interesting work by young filmmakers in India. We do hope that we get to showcase more of such work in Cut.In in the years to come. We congratulate all the participants for their creativity, energy and commitment to the medium.

Documentary

a)      Gold: Char Dukan

Director – Arvind Caulagi

For its evocative and lyrical cinematic representation of times past and its compassionate engagement with the protagonist

b)      Silver: A Dream called America

Director – Anoop Sathyan

For its skillful portrayal of the inter-generational conflict and aspirations

PSA

Special Mention of the Jury: Reading Inspires

Director – Priya Goswami

For foregrounding the curiosity in a child’s mind that helps discover the joys of reading

Fiction

a)      Gold: Open Cafe v2.5

Director – Naveen Padmanabha

For its reflexive mode which brings together various narratives: the real, the imaginary, the past and the present

b)      Silver: Nirgun

Director – Parthib Dutta

For the deft and skilful story telling that brings to fore the irony of the cultural dynamics around the family

The 4th ‘Cut.In’ Students Film Festival will be held as a part of “Resonance at Tata Institute of Social Sciences, Mumbai on the 21st and 22nd December 2011.

The festival is being organized by the Centre for Media and Cultural Studies (CMCS), Tata Institute of Social Sciences. This year Cut.In is organized as a part of  “Resonance” as the institute is celebrating its platinum jubilee.  CMCS is an independent centre of  Tata Institute of Social Sciences, engaged in media teaching, production, research and dissemination.A unique feature of the Centre is the close linkage between the technical and academic areas of its work, thus facilitating a synergy between research, teaching and production, all of which are informed by a keen sense of connection with local subaltern cultures of resistance and invention.The CMCS has done pioneering work in critical media education in the country. Currently the Centre runs a two-year Masters degree in Media and Cultural Studies focusing on professional media practice and research within a framework that enables the development of a critical perspective on media, culture and society. It seeks to enable the creation of a lively group of thinking doers and doing thinkers.

This international level film festival aims to encourage talent among this group of thinking doers and doing thinkers and aim to bring the aspiring and the inspiring.  The competition is for short documentaries, short films, public service messages and music videos.

Entries are invited for the following categories:
a) Documentary (under 45 min)
b) Short fiction (under 45 min)
c) Public Service Message (Under 2 min)

The festival will feature works by graduate/postgraduate/diploma students all over the country and other interested international students selected by a panel of judges.

Two prizes will be given in each category.

The prize consists of a trophy and a citation.

In addition there are prizes for Best Cinematography, Editing and Sound Design.
